The chief minister of Punjab (Punjabi/Urdu: وزیرِ اعلیٰ پنجاب, romanizedWazīr-ē-Aʿlā Panjāb) is the head of government of the Pakistani province of Punjab. Elected by the Provincial Assembly of the Punjab, the chief minister leads the executive branch of the government of Punjab along with their appointed cabinet, with the governor of Punjab serving as the nominal head of executive and province. The chief minister is elected by a majority in the Punjab Assembly, where they serve as leader of the House. The office is held by virtue of the officeholder's ability to command the confidence of the Assembly, with no term limits. Maryam Nawaz Sharif is the 19th and current chief minister of Punjab.

The office of Chief Minister is located in Lahore, the capital of the Punjab province and is known as the CM Secretariat.
